Chemsultants is a full-service research and development laboratory capable of testing and formulating a broad range of label, tag, and adhesive products for conformance to the standards of TLMI, ASTM, PSTC, AFERA, and FINAT. The group of Chemsultants scientists specializes in the benchmarking and developing of PSAs and heat seal adhesives and coatings, specialty inks and sealants, as well as thermoplastic and thermoset coatings and films. The laboratory is A2LA certified.
ChemDevelopment
ChemDevelopment is a state-of-the-art facility offering complete pilot coating, laminating, converting and slitting services. Our capabilities include application of PSA and heat seal adhesives, release coatings and specialty polymer systems to a wide variety of substrates. We are capable of mixing 5 to 250 gallon batches, coating webs, using one of eight coating methods and drying via thermal or UV processes, using 3 coating lines ranging from 12 to 40 wide.
ChemInstruments
ChemInstruments designs, manufactures and sells a full line of testing equipment for the adhesive, sealant, ink and converting industries. Our line of instruments has been developed to test TLMI, ASTM, PSTC, AFERA and FINAT standards in the areas of tack, shear, release, adhesion, peel and tensile. In addition, we offer a line of lab coating and laminating equipment, as well as sampling and supply items, sold and serviced through our 14 representatives worldwide.
